Comprehending How a CVT Gearbox Works

A continuously variable transmission (CVT) works in a unique fashion. Unlike traditional gearboxes with determined ratios, a CVT features a system of belts and pulleys to modify the gear ratio continuously. This enables the engine to operate at its most effective RPM across a wide range of speeds. A driver can smoothly increase speed or decelerate without any noticeable gear transitions.

  • The central merit of a CVT is its refined transitions.
  • As a result, it often provides a more comfortable driving journey.
  • Moreover, CVTs are known for their fuel efficiency.

Diagnosing Common CVT Problems

A continuously variable transmission commonly delivers a smooth and seamless driving experience. However, like any complex mechanical system, CVTs can develop issues over time. When your CVT starts to act up, it's crucial to diagnose the problem promptly. Some of the most common CVT problems include slipping gears, hesitation during acceleration, whining noises, and rough shifting.

  • Carrying out regular fluid refills is essential for CVT health.
  • Checking the transmission belt and pulley system for wear and tear can reveal potential problems early on.
  • Consulting your vehicle's owner's manual for specific troubleshooting advice is always a good starting point.

If you suspect a major CVT issue, it's best to take your vehicle to a qualified mechanic specializing in transmission repair.
